About this role

Libraries Connected is a charity strengthening England's public library networks, and this role helps those regional networks grow their capacity and impact. You'll build relationships across libraries, support strategic partnerships, and help secure government funding to keep the work going. It suits a generalist who can move between relationship-building, strategy, and the practical work of making a network actually function.
